Scientific Name | Micronema moorei Smith, 1945 |
Common Name | |
Type Locality | Menam Chao Phya, near Paknampo, central Thailand. |
Pronunciation | mike row NEE mah |
Etymology | From the Greek mikros, meaning small, and nema, meaning thread. In reference to the relatively small barbels . |

Size | 240mm or 9.4" SL. Find near, nearer or same sized spp. |

Distribution | Asia: Chao Phrya (Thailand) and lower Mekong. Thailand Waters, Chao Praya (click on these areas to find other species found there) Mekong, Lower Mekong (click on these areas to find other species found there) Log in to view data on a map. |

Other Parameters | Inhabits streams and canals in the floodplain. |
Husbandry Information | |
Feeding | In the wild feeds mainly on small fishes as well as prawns and insect larvae. User data. |
